And The Winner Is...
The 2008 Lifetime Achievement recipient is Richard S. Sommerville. This award is the highest honor in the MAB Broadcasting Hall of Fame. Sommerville was active in broadcasting for over 50 years, owning several radio stations and local newspapers. Pictured above (l-r) Karole White, President/CEO of MAB; (seated) Richard S. Sommerville, owner, Sommerville Communications;
and Richard’s son, Jim Sommerville.

WWJ-TV Hires National Sales Manager
Mike Montano has been named national sales manager for WWJ, the CBS O&O in Detroit, effective June 30. He will report directly to Jennifer Purtan, vice president and director of sales, WWJ and co-owned WKBD, who made the announcement.

WLUN hires sales director
Lance LeFevre has been hired to serve as the director of sales for ESPN 100.9-FM/WLUN (Pinconning). In this role, LeFevre is in charge of all radio sponsorship sales and maintaining relationships with the station's partners. LeFevre previously worked with the Great Lakes Loons as a corporate account executive.

Court Sets Limits on FOIA
The Michigan Supreme Court placed news limits on the Freedom of Information Act (FOIA), giving public entities more freedom to limit information. The new restriction came as result of a pair of rulings released today involving Michigan State University and the University of Michigan.

Amendment Targets Legislative Pay, Term Limits
Rep. Mark Meadows (D-East Lansing) recently introduced a constitutional amendment that would scale back pay for legislators, deduct from their salary for absences, and would completely abolish term limits. The resolution represent yet another in a long line of proposal to counter the controversial Reform Michigan Government Now! ballot initiative.

Public Broadcasters Pioneer Award
The MAPB honored recipients with the Pioneer awards at the Chairman’s Banquet held on July 15, 2008. Honored with the Volunteer Pioneer award is the WGVU Telephone Pioneers. The Professional Pioneer award recipient is Ken Kolbe. Pictured (l-r) are Michael Walenta, General Manager, WGVU-AM/FM/TV (Grand Rapids) accepting on behalf of the Telephone Pioneers; Karole White, Executive Director, Michigan Association of Public Broadcasters; and Ken Kolbe, Assistant General Manager/Technology Manager, WGVU-AM/FM/TV.

Voter registrations accepted all Michigan Department of Human Services county offices
Michigan residents can add any Department of Human Services location across the state as places there they can register to vote. Individuals seeing caseworkers, conducting supervised visitations or visiting the offices for any reason can complete and submit voter registration materials.
